Before diving right into the ins and outs of fintech, it is vital to understand what is fintech? To put it simply, fintech get more info describes the application of technological innovation into the financial services market. According to the fintech growth statistics, fintech is being embraced by an increasing number of conventional financial institutions, as indicated by the France fintech industry. With such an escalated growth rate, it is natural to question why fintech is becoming so prominent. Essentially, fintech is growing in appeal solely because of the reality that it has several potential perks. These advantages influence not only the financial institutions themselves, but also the customers from the broader society. From a business viewpoint, one of the greatest incentives to using fintech is the reality that it lowers costs. Traditional financial establishments usually include countless operational and transaction expenditures, varying from processing costs and administrative prices. The charm of using fintech is that it dramatically reduces costs by eliminating some of the many stages and processes. For instance, blockchain technology streamlines cross-border payments by deploying a decentralised ledger, which in turn eliminates the need for expensive currency exchanges and associated fees.

With fintech on the rise, it is natural for individuals to weigh up all the advantages and disadvantages of fintech technologies, products and services. In terms of the advantages, the boosted efficiency is certainly one of its most standout features which appeals to conventional financial organizations. Among the main goals of fintech is to drastically reduce the quantity of time and resources that are needed for various financial procedures. To achieve this, automation plays a pivotal role in streamlining a range of different tasks which can be time-consuming and require manual labour. For example, AI-driven algorithms have the power to automate procedures such as credit scoring and claims processing, which consequently considerably speeds up the total response times. Not just this, but it likewise improves efficiency by reducing the risk for human mistake.

From a consumer point of view, the very best feature of fintech is that it improves their overall experience, as shown by the Sweden fintech field. As an example, AI and machine learning has the capability to evaluate vast volumes of customer data in order to offer personalised financial guidance and customised services for individuals. The use of chatbots and digital assistants makes it feasible for firms to offer 24/7 customer service, handle inquiries and manage transactions without the need for human interference. Subsequently, this saves customers a huge amount of time and is a a lot more convenient solution for them.
